Chief Executive Officer (Exclusive)
VANRATH are delighted to be working exclusively with a thriving UK business operating within the health & social care space to recruit a strategic Chief Executive Officer (CEO) the lead the business through its next phase of growth.
The primary focus of the CEO will be to provide strategic leadership and ensure the organisation delivers a high-quality service while remaining financially strong and compliant with regulatory standards. Focus on challenging the senior leadership team to control costs and manage resources must be maintained. Other key priorities are to identify, interpret and capitalise on market risks and opportunities, and develop the strategy for future growth.

The Role:
- Develop and implement strategies and policies to ensure that the organisation meets its medium- and long-term goals.
- Formulate the strategic plan and annual budget to align with business objectives.
- Manage the relationship with the funding bank and ensure the bank's requirements are satisfied, including adherence to budgets and achieving covenants as applicable.
- Financial control to ensure enhanced operating profit
- Monitor detailed financial performance to ensure compliance with the business plan.
- Identify efficiency measures to improve operational performance and ensure the organisation's goals are met.
- Lead and support the senior leadership team and ensure the organisation's staff are focused on achieving its mission and aims.
- Attendance at senior leadership meetings to input and challenge both financial and non-financial activities to achieve solutions and improvements.
- Ensure that the business fulfils its legal, statutory and regulatory responsibilities.
- Build relationships with external stakeholders
